Liverpool are sweating on the fitness of Curtis Jones after the midfielder became the latest injury concern for Arne Slot. Jones was substituted for teenager Rio Ngumoha 20 minutes from time during the Reds’ dismal 3-2 Premier League defeat at Brentford on Saturday evening.
The midfielder, who had been one of very few Liverpool players to approach anywhere near their normal level of performance, sat on the turf before being asked to be substituted.
And Reds boss Slot explained: “Curtis, we have to wait and see. He asked to be taken off but he walked off instead of needing treatment.
Jones will now be regarded as a doubt for the League Cup visit of Crystal Palace on Wednesday, the fourth in a run of seven pivotal games in 22 days for Liverpool.
Slot was without midfielder Ryan Gravenberch and striker Alexander Isakat the Gtech Community Stadium due to ankle and groin problems respectively.
The duo joined hamstrung duo Alisson Becker and Jeremie Frimpong on the sidelines while teenage centre-back Giovanni Leoni is out for the season after ACL surgery.
